Output ed324dea31d47cb45a9a2a24139a45dfb8e188d5813b06e94404ccf74aa156e1:42

value
1166384
script pubkey
OP_0 OP_PUSHBYTES_20 18bd767f37f0ca55fa5bc0e37b139d61726d76a3
address
bc1qrz7hvleh7r99t7jmcr3hkyuav9ex6a4rt7x30e
transaction
ed324dea31d47cb45a9a2a24139a45dfb8e188d5813b06e94404ccf74aa156e1
spent
true